FIELD: machine building.
SUBSTANCE: proposed gearing comprises meshed pinion 1 and gear wheel 2. Profiles of tooth roots 4 of pinion 1 and wheel 2 are delineated by radial straight lines. Pinion tip profiles 5 are delineated by circle evolvents that are both primary and pitch.
EFFECT: higher efficiency, invariable gear ratio, higher manufacturability.
